[Bug 255008] Re: Up arrow key mapped to Print [screen]

2008-09-21 Thread Dominique Quatravaux
Another workaround that just worked for me: add blacklist evdev to /etc/modprobe.d/blacklist then run /sbin/update-modules as root, and reboot. The behavior of the keyboard and mouse is thereafter reverted to what it was under Hardy Heron, no xorg.conf changes or setxkbmap voodoo needed. --

Re: [Bug 272504] Re: DVD plays poorly with horizonatal lines that break up picture

2008-09-21 Thread Mackenzie Morgan
Yes, it's a package for decrypting DRM'd DVDs, something the US DMCA doesn't allow, but which is legal in other countries. For that reason, it's not in Ubuntu's repositories. medibuntu.org has it. -- DVD plays poorly with horizonatal lines that break up picture
